Question
According to a report publish by the pew research center in Feb, 2010, 61% of Mi8llienials (american in their teens and 20's) think that their generations has a unique and distinctive identity (N-527)
a. Calculate the 95% confidence interval to estimate the percentage of melenials who believe that their generations has a distinctive identity as compared with other generations (generations X,, baby boomers or silent generations)
b. calculate the 99% confidence interval
c. Are both these results compatible with the conclusion that the majority of millenials believe that they have a unique identity that separates them from the previous generations?
Explanation / Answer
a.
Confidence Interval For Proportion
CI = p ± Z a/2 Sqrt(p*(1-p)/n)))
x = Mean
n = Sample Size
a = 1 - (Confidence Level/100)
Za/2 = Z-table value
CI = Confidence Interval
Sample Size(n)=527
Sample proportion = x/n =0.61
Confidence Interval = [ 0.61 ±Z a/2 ( Sqrt ( 0.61*0.39) /527)]
= [ 0.61 - 1.96* Sqrt(0) , 0.61 + 1.96* Sqrt(0) ]
= [ 0.568,0.652]
b.
AT 99% C.I
Confidence Interval = [ 0.61 ±Z a/2 ( Sqrt ( 0.61*0.39) /527)]
= [ 0.61 - 2.576* Sqrt(0) , 0.61 + 2.58* Sqrt(0) ]
= [ 0.555,0.665]
c.
Yes, because the intervals achive higher value than stated in earlier
